1000 Apple distribution problems

Old Wang has 1000 apples in boxes numbered 1-10. No matter how many apples a customer needs to buy, he can always follow the appropriate boxes numbered, the total number of apples in these boxes is exactly the same as the customer's needs. How did Old Wang do that?

Tip: this interesting question is about binary sensitivity.

 

Answer: We can use the binary method to allocate the number of apples in each box.

Box No.: 1 2 3 4 5 6 7 8 9 10

Apple count: 1 2 4 8 16 32 64 128 256 489 (512-23)

Why is the last box 489? Because the total number of apples is 1000. If the last box is 512, the total number will exceed 1000, and the total number will be 489, only in this way can the customer be freely combined as long as the customer needs to satisfy the customer
